Model United Nations (MUN) at LANNA

Each year, LANNA students organize and participate in two Model United Nations (MUN) conferences in Northern Thailand. LANNA was one of the founding members of the Chiang Mai Model United Nations organization fifteen years ago, and CMMUN conferences attract international schools from Chiang Mai, Chiang Rai, Bangkok and neighboring countries. Lanna International School performance at the Model United Nations Conference

LANNA students, along with those from eight other international schools, participated in the Chiang Mai Model United Nations (CMMUN) conference hosted by Prem Tinsulanonda International School in Mae Rim.
